Draft-Treaty of Mutual Recognition, Baracao-Shireroth

August 11th, 2003

In the hopes and pursuit of friendly and congenial relations between the people and governments of the involved nations, namely the Republic of Shireroth and the Republic of Baracao, we are to engage in a treaty of mutual recognition. As it stands, the legality of this treaty is to be recognized by all nations, and subject only to applicable laws in the Republics of Baracao and Shireroth.

In this document, both nations shall be referred to by acronym:
The Republic of Shireroth shall henceforth be referred to as the R.O.S.
The Republic of Baracao shall henceforth be referred to as the R.O.B.

I-Intended purpose of treaty

As a statement of intent, it is stated that the purpose of this treaty is to establish and strengthen relations of a friendly and peaceful nature. Through the processes each government has in place to make official these proceedings, it is hoped that the establishment of trade and other business exchanges will bolster the economic positions of each nation and work to form closer bonds between us.



II-Recognition of the legality of governments

It will stand clearly stated that the ideological differences present between the governments of the R.O.S and the R.O.B will not be an overriding factor in all diplomatic affairs. The governments and institutions are recognized as legal and just in the eyes of the citizens of each nation and answerable only to the citizens and peoples of the nation at question.



III-Recognition of Dual Citizenships

Persons in possession of citizenships in both the R.O.S and the R.O.B shall henceforth be endowed with the natural and legal rights of a full citizen in both nations.
